namespace TrafficManager.Util.Extensions {
using ColossalFramework;
using TrafficManager.API.Traffic.Enums;
using TrafficManager.Manager.Impl;
public static class VehicleExtensions {
private static Vehicle[] _vehicleBuffer = Singleton<VehicleManager>.instance.m_vehicles.m_buffer;
/// <summary>Returns a reference to the vehicle instance.</summary>
/// <param name="vehicleId">The ID of the vehicle instance to obtain.</param>
/// <returns>The vehicle instance.</returns>
public static ref Vehicle ToVehicle(this ushort vehicleId) => ref _vehicleBuffer[vehicleId];
/// <summary>Returns a reference to the vehicle instance.</summary>
/// <param name="vehicleId">The ID of the vehicle instance to obtain.</param>
/// <returns>The vehicle instance.</returns>
public static ref Vehicle ToVehicle(this uint vehicleId) => ref _vehicleBuffer[vehicleId];
public static bool IsCreated(this ref Vehicle vehicle) =>
vehicle.m_flags.IsFlagSet(Vehicle.Flags.Created);
public static bool IsParking(this ref Vehicle vehicle) =>
vehicle.m_flags.IsFlagSet(Vehicle.Flags.Parking);
/// <summary>
/// Checks if the vehicle is Created, but not Deleted.
/// </summary>
/// <param name="vehicle">vehicle</param>
/// <returns>True if the vehicle is valid, otherwise false.</returns>
public static bool IsValid(this ref Vehicle vehicle) =>
vehicle.m_flags.CheckFlags(
required: Vehicle.Flags.Created,
forbidden: Vehicle.Flags.Deleted);
public static bool IsWaitingPath(this ref Vehicle vehicle) =>
vehicle.m_flags.IsFlagSet(Vehicle.Flags.WaitingPath);
/// <summary>Determines the <see cref="ExtVehicleType"/> for a vehicle based on its AI.</summary>
/// <param name="vehicle">The vehicle to inspect.</param>
/// <param name="vehicleId">The vehicle ID to inspect.</param>
/// <returns>The extended vehicle type.</returns>
/// <remarks>This works for any vehicle type, including those which TM:PE doesn't manage.</remarks>
public static ExtVehicleType ToExtVehicleType(this ref Vehicle vehicle, ushort vehicleId)
=> vehicle.IsValid()
? GetTypeFromVehicleAI(vehicleId, ref vehicle)
: ExtVehicleType.None;
/// <summary>Determines the <see cref="ExtVehicleType"/> for a managed vehicle type.</summary>
/// <param name="vehicleId">The id of the vehicle to inspect.</param>
/// <returns>The extended vehicle type.</returns>
/// <remarks>
/// Only works for managed vehicle types listed in <see cref="ExtVehicleManager.VEHICLE_TYPES"/>
/// </remarks>
public static ExtVehicleType ToExtVehicleType(this ushort vehicleId)
=> ExtVehicleManager.Instance.ExtVehicles[vehicleId].vehicleType;
/// <summary>Determines the <see cref="ExtVehicleType"/> for a managed vehicle type.</summary>
/// <param name="vehicleId">The id of the vehicle to inspect.</param>
/// <returns>The extended vehicle type.</returns>
/// <remarks>
/// Only works for managed vehicle types listed in <see cref="ExtVehicleManager.VEHICLE_TYPES"/>
/// </remarks>
public static ExtVehicleType ToExtVehicleType(this uint vehicleId)
=> ExtVehicleManager.Instance.ExtVehicles[vehicleId].vehicleType;
public static ExtVehicleType MapToExtVehicleTypeRestrictions(this VehicleInfo.VehicleCategory category, bool checkTrains) {
if (category == VehicleInfo.VehicleCategory.None) {
return ExtVehicleType.None;
}
ExtVehicleType type = ExtVehicleType.None;
if ((category & VehicleInfo.VehicleCategory.PassengerCar) != 0) {
type |= ExtVehicleType.PassengerCar;
}
if ((category & VehicleInfo.VehicleCategory.CargoTruck) != 0) {
type |= ExtVehicleType.CargoTruck;
}
if ((category & VehicleInfo.VehicleCategory.Bus) != 0) {
type |= ExtVehicleType.Bus;
}
if ((category & VehicleInfo.VehicleCategory.Trolleybus) != 0) {
type |= ExtVehicleType.Bus;
}
if ((category & VehicleInfo.VehicleCategory.Taxi) != 0) {
type |= ExtVehicleType.Taxi;
}
if ((category & VehicleInfo.VehicleCategory.Hearse) != 0) {
type |= ExtVehicleType.Service;
}
if ((category & (VehicleInfo.VehicleCategory.CityServices & ~VehicleInfo.VehicleCategory.Emergency)) != 0) {
type |= ExtVehicleType.Service;
}
if ((category & VehicleInfo.VehicleCategory.Emergency) != 0) {
type |= ExtVehicleType.Emergency;
}
if (checkTrains) {
if ((category & VehicleInfo.VehicleCategory.Trains) != 0) {
type |= ExtVehicleType.RailVehicle;
}
}
return type;
}
/// <summary>
/// Maps VehicleCategory to ExtVehicleType - works correctly only for VehicleType.Car or shared with Car (Car | Tram)
/// Useful as a fallback in case of CreatePath request for not explicitly supported AIs (including custom)
/// </summary>
/// <param name="category"></param>
/// <returns></returns>
public static ExtVehicleType MapCarVehicleCategoryToExtVehicle(this VehicleInfo.VehicleCategory category) {
if ((category & (VehicleInfo.VehicleCategory.Ambulance |
VehicleInfo.VehicleCategory.FireTruck |
VehicleInfo.VehicleCategory.Police |
VehicleInfo.VehicleCategory.Disaster |
VehicleInfo.VehicleCategory.VacuumTruck)) != 0) {
return ExtVehicleType.Emergency;
} else if ((category & (VehicleInfo.VehicleCategory.GarbageTruck |
VehicleInfo.VehicleCategory.Hearse |
VehicleInfo.VehicleCategory.MaintenanceTruck |
VehicleInfo.VehicleCategory.ParkTruck |
VehicleInfo.VehicleCategory.PostTruck |
VehicleInfo.VehicleCategory.SnowTruck |
VehicleInfo.VehicleCategory.BankTruck)) != 0) {
return ExtVehicleType.Service;
} else if ((category & VehicleInfo.VehicleCategory.Bus) != 0) {
return ExtVehicleType.Bus;
} else if ((category & VehicleInfo.VehicleCategory.Trolleybus) != 0) {
return ExtVehicleType.Trolleybus;
} else if ((category & VehicleInfo.VehicleCategory.CargoTruck) != 0) {
return ExtVehicleType.CargoTruck;
} else if ((category & VehicleInfo.VehicleCategory.PassengerCar) != 0) {
return ExtVehicleType.PassengerCar;
} else if ((category & VehicleInfo.VehicleCategory.Taxi) != 0) {
return ExtVehicleType.Taxi;
} else if ((category & VehicleInfo.VehicleCategory.Tram) != 0) {
return ExtVehicleType.Tram;
}
return ExtVehicleType.None;
}
/// <summary>
/// Inspects the AI of the <paramref name="vehicle"/> to determine its type.
/// </summary>
/// <param name="vehicleId">The vehicle id to inspect.</param>
/// <param name="vehicle">The vehicle to inspect.</param>
/// <returns>The determined <see cref="ExtVehicleType"/>.</returns>
/// <remarks>If vehicle AI not recognised, returns <see cref="ExtVehicleType.None"/>.</remarks>
private static ExtVehicleType GetTypeFromVehicleAI(ushort vehicleId, ref Vehicle vehicle) {
VehicleInfo info = vehicle.Info;
if (!info) {
// broken assets may have broken Info instance but still valid flags
// (probably other mods prevent proper skipping of broken assets)
return ExtVehicleType.None;
}
var vehicleAI = info.m_vehicleAI;
var emergency = vehicle.m_flags.IsFlagSet(Vehicle.Flags.Emergency2);
var ret = ExtVehicleManager.Instance.DetermineVehicleTypeFromAIType(
vehicleId,
vehicleAI,
emergency);
return ret ?? ExtVehicleType.None;
}
}
}
